A medical alert system in Cazadero can supply numerous elderly and disabled people with the ability to survive on their own, and work out a high degree of independence. Here’s exactly what you need to know prior to registering with a medical alert system supplier.
Technically, an alert system is usually consisted of a wrist band transmitter– looking like a wrist watch– or a necklace-type transmitter that is used at all times. If the person needs to have a medical problem or mishap, they can simply push a button on the worn transmitter to interact with the medical alert monitoring center.
This assists the tracking center specialist to better advise you in case of a medical emergency, and they may also send out emergency medical aid if needed. Optionally, the monitoring center can be advised to also contact several of your family members whenever the help button is pressed.The cost of a medical alert system can differ inning accordance with the level of service you require, but in general they are a really reasonably-priced alternative to assisted living centers.

Panic Buttons for the elderly are available in many choices and with many functions. Basically a panic button is an emergency button which can be pressed in case of an emergency, whether it be a fall, or heart attack. These panic buttons can be worn around the neck or as a bracelet.
Panic buttons can be one method or 2-way. A one way panic button for the elderly will operate in one way only. The individual in distress presses a button, which sends out a signal. Typically this will put an emergency call to the numbers currently configured into the system.
When an individual takes the call, he is asked to enter in a number. If the number is gotten in properly, then the system assumes that it is a live person and not an answering device. The system will play the message for the individual lifting the call.
In a 2-way system, a 2-way communication is developed between the person in distress and the emergency alert provider. This is why it is crucial you choose a trusted provider. It is well worth the few extra dollars invested monthly, in return for quality service and response.
Some 2-way service providers will supply additional service. For instance some alarm companies will bring up medical records of the client to determine if he has any known medical issues. This makes sure immediate service and can avoid a lot of hassle and frustration.
Panic buttons for the senior can be used as a bracelet, pendant or on the belt. They are normally water proof so there is no issues with the emergency alert systems getting spoiled due to wetness.

Senior Alert Systems and Medical Alert Devices FAQ
-
- Do You want a Home-Based or Mobile System?
Initially, medical alert systems were created to work inside your home, with your landline telephone.
And you can still go that route. Many business likewise now provide the alternative of home-based systems that work over a cellular network, for those who may not have a landline.
With these systems, pushing the wearable call button permits you to speak to a dispatcher through a base system located in your house.
Many companies offer mobile choices, too. You can utilize these systems in your home, however they’ll also enable you to call for help while you’re out and about.
These run over cellular networks and integrate GPS technology. By doing this, if you get lost or push the call button for assistance but are unable to talk, the monitoring service can locate you.

- Should You Add a Fall-Detection Feature?
Some companies offer the option of automatic fall detection, for an additional monthly fee. Manufacturers say these devices sense falls when they occur and automatically contact the dispatch center, just as they would if you had pressed the call button.
-
- Whats the Cost?
Fees. Beware of complicated pricing plans and hidden fees. Look for a company with no extra fees related to equipment, shipping, installation, activation, or service and repair. Don’t fall for scams that offer free service or “donated or used” equipment.
Contracts. You should not have to enter into a long-term contract. You should only have to pay ongoing monthly fees, which should range between $25 and $45 a month (about $1 a day). Be careful about paying for service in advance, since you never know when you’ll need to stop the service temporarily (due to a hospitalization, for instance) or permanently.
Guarantee and cancellation policies. Look for a full money-back guarantee, or at least a trial period, in case you are not satisfied with the service. And you’ll want the ability to cancel at any time with no penalties (and a full refund if monthly fees have already been paid).
Discounts. Ask about discounts for multiple people in the same household, as well as for veterans, membership organizations, medical insurance or via a hospital, medical or care organization. Ask if the company offers any discount options or a sliding fee scale for people with lower incomes.
Insurance. For the most part, Medicare and private insurance companies will not cover the costs of a medical alert. In some states Medicaid may cover all or part of the cost. You can check with your private insurance company to see if it offers discounts or referrals.
Tax deductions. Check with your tax professional to find out if the cost of a medical alert is tax deductible as a medically necessary expense.

Cazadero, California
Cazadero is an unincorporated community and census-designated place (CDP) in western Sonoma County, California, United States with a population of 420. Nearby towns include Jenner, Annapolis, Stewart's Point, Duncans Mills, Villa Grande, Rio Nido, Guerneville, Monte Rio, and The Sea Ranch. The downtown of Cazadero consists of two churches, a general store, a post office, a hardware store, an auto repair garage, private office space, and the Cazadero Volunteer Fire Department.
Cazadero is the general area from the confluence of Austin Creek and the Russian River at the intersection of California State Route 116 and Cazadero Highway running north to the small town of the same name. The town is approximately 6 miles from Route 116. Cazadero Highway parallels Austin Creek which is a principal tributary of the lower Russian River. Austin Creek flows southward from two major forks through the town to the Russian River. Just north of the town, Cazadero Highway is joined by Fort Ross Road which is a winding, narrow road that meanders west before reaching State Route 1 on the Pacific Ocean near an old fort established by the Russians after they invaded in the 19th century. Located in the Sonoma Coast AVA, Cazadero can also be considered part of the Wine Country. Flowers, Fort Ross, Hirsch and Wild Hog Wineries have Cazadero addresses and all operate in the vicinity of the town. Cazadero is approximately 10 miles (16 km) from the Pacific Ocean, the Sonoma Coast and the mouth of the Russian River.
Cazadero was the northern terminus of the North Pacific Coast Railroad, originally laid as narrow-gauge track in the 1870s. This railhead was fed by several smaller gauge systems dedicated to logging and networks of logging roads and trails which brought trees to Duncans Mill for processing and shipment south to San Francisco. Local legend holds that much of San Francisco was rebuilt after the disastrous April 1906 earthquake and fire using redwood and other lumber from the Cazadero area. Cazadero timbers are also known to have been used in pilings sunk to support the old (and now partially demolished) eastern span of the San Francisco-Oakland Bay Bridge.
